Transaction 7100c77edacf3ab7c496f852c45f16f193b39efd1574a77f66bd76279d1b2459

block
6a0a33bd55fbf40c9964eb2a3e08d63ce47c06839b44c6563833cf4268a1b399

1 Input

25 Outputs